About This School
Corona Del Sol High School is a high school located in Tempe, Arizona. The school serves 2,733 students in grades 9-12. The student-to-teacher ratio is 22.8:1.
According to EDFacts assessment data, 68% of students meet grade-level proficiency standards in combined math and reading. The school reports a 83% graduation rate.
13% of students qualify for free or reduced-price lunch.
Corona Del Sol High School is part of the Tempe Union High School District (4287) in Arizona.
How This School Compares
Corona Del Sol High School has 2,733 students enrolled, making it larger than the average school in Tempe Union High School District (4287) (1,809 students). Its 68% proficiency rate is 13 percentage points above the district average of 56%. Compared to the Arizona state average of 48%, the school performs 20 points higher. The 22.8:1 student-teacher ratio is above the national average of 16:1.
